Macaroni and Cheese Recipe

Ingredients:

8 oz.(1/2 pkg.) elbow macaroni,
1/4 cup margarine or butter,
3 tbsp. all-purpose flour,
1/8 tsp. salt(optional),
1/8 tsp. dry mustard,
1/8 tsp. black pepper,
2 cups milk,
2 cups (8 oz.) shredded sharp cheddar cheese,
1 cup croutons.



Directions:

Cook macaroni 3 minutes. Drain, cover and set aside. Preheat oven to 350º. In mediun saucepan, melt margarine or butter, blend in flour, mustard, salt and pepper. Cook until mixture is smooth and bubbly; gradually add milk. Cook and stir over medium heat until mixture boils; simmer 1 minute, stirring constantly. Gradually mix in cheese. Stir over low heat until cheese is melted. Add macaroni; mix together lightly. Pour into 2 qt. casserole. Top with croutons. Bake 25 minutes.
